ALGEBRA
TERMS
Question | Answer |
---|---|
Rational numbers | A number that can be expressed as an integer or a quotient of integers. For example, 2, -5, and 1 / 2 are rational. 有理数 |
Integers | any rational number that can be expressed as the sum or difference of a finite number of units, being a member of the set …--3, --2, --1, 0, 1, 2, 3… 整数 |
Quotients | The number that results when one number is divided by another. If 6 is divided by 3, the quotient can be represented as 2, or as 6 ÷ 3, or as the fraction 6 / 3 . 商数 |
Whole numbers | Also called counting number. one of the positive integers or zero; any of the numbers (0, 1, 2, 3, …). A member of the set of positive integers and zero. |
Irrational numbers | any real number that cannot be expressed as the ratio of two integers, such as π 无理数 |
Linear equation | Solving the linear equation is isolating the variable on one side |
